Answer:
The expected number of bowerbirds in the sample that will have bower featuring reflective color is E(X)=0.9
Step-by-step explanation:
We can model this with a binomial random variable, with sample size n=3 and probability of success p=0.3.
The expected number of bowerbirds in the sample that will have bower featuring reflective color can be calculated as:
